What are transformerless grid-connected inverters?
Abstract: Transformerless grid-connected inverters (TLI) feature high efficiency, low cost, low volume, and weight due to using neither line-frequency transformers nor high-frequency transformers.
Are transformerless PV systems more efficient than isolated PV systems?
In Ref. , according to the comparison of 400 contemporary PV inverters, authors show that the efficiency of transformerless PV systems can be 1%–2% greater than isolated PV systems, regardless of whether a high-frequency or low-frequency transformer is taken into account.
